Newsible Asia launches a first-of-its-kind international platform to honor children from Asia and of Asian origin

In an unprecedented step toward recognizing young achievers, Newsible Asia, Asia’s fastest growing digital news platform, has officially launched The Honor List — a premium initiative to identify, honor, and amplify the voices of children under 18 who are making an impact in any meaningful way.

Whether in academics, innovation, sports, the arts, or social action, The Honor List is set to become a prestigious platform where the stories of young changemakers are celebrated with depth, dignity, and global reach.
